"Beat Up" (PhrasalAdjective And PhrasalVerb)


1. verb To physically attack someone, as with punches and other blows, such that they suffer significant injury. In this usage, a noun or pronoun can be used between "beat" and "up." The captain of the football team swore he would beat me up if I ever talked to his girlfriend again. I can't believe that skinny kid beat up the school bully!

( transitive) To give a severe beating to; to assault violently with repeated blows . I got beaten up by thugs on my way home. You don't beat people up, so that you can live in a society where nobody would beat you up. ( obsolete) To attack suddenly; to alarm . To cause, by some other means, injuries comparable to the result of being beaten up.
